I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
READ BEFORE USING
• ONLY use the meter for the purposes set out in this manual.
• Do not use ANY accessories not specied by the manufacturer.
• Do NOT use the meter if it is malfunctioning or damaged.
• This meter is not designed to cure given symptoms or diseases. The measured data serve
solely as reference values. Always consult your diabetes physician and/or GP for the proper
interpretation of the results you have measured.
• Read all the instructions carefully and practice the procedure a number of times before
actually testing your blood sugar and/or ketone levels. Perform all quality checks in
accordance with the instructions.
• Keep the meter and all its parts out of reach of young children. Small parts, such as the
battery cover, the batteries, test strips, lancets and caps are a potential choking hazard.
• Use the meter in a dry environment, especially if synthetic materials are present (such as
synthetic clothing or carpeting), which can cause a static charge that could mean incorrect
results.
• Do NOT use the meter near sources of strong electromagnetic currents, as the accuracy of
the measurement could be affected.
• Proper maintenance is essential to the operating life of your meter. If you are worried
about the accuracy of your measurements, contact customer support or your distributor for
support.
